A RECTANGULAR CARVED IVORY DIPTYCH PANEL OF THE CRUCIFIXION
FRENCH, EARLY 14TH CENTURY
Christ flanked by the Virgin and St. John the Evangelist, all under a trilobe arch, in a later textile-covered stand; cracks, damages and wear
4 1/8 in. (10.4 cm.) high
